According to the USDA, a standard serving of dry pasta is 2 ounces, which for elbow macaroni translates to approximately ½ cup. Mastering the correct portion size is essential for balancing your meals and ensuring proper portion control, especially with compact pasta shapes like elbow macaroni.

According to Barilla, a standard serving of dried pasta is 56 grams (2 ounces), meaning 400 grams of pasta provides approximately seven servings. However, the actual number of servings can vary significantly based on appetite, whether the pasta is a main or side dish, and its type (dried, fresh, or filled).
